    Product Description:
    5,6-trans-1alpha,25-Dihydroxyvitamin D3 is a synthetic analog of the active form of vitamin D, calcitriol (1α,25-dihydroxyvitamin D3). It features a modified stereochemistry at the C-5 and C-6 positions of the seco-steroid B-ring, resulting in the 5,6-trans configuration. This structural alteration distinguishes it from the natural hormone. This compound is a potent agonist of the vitamin D receptor (VDR). It exhibits biological activities similar to calcitriol, including the regulation of calcium and phosphate homeostasis, cell differentiation, and immune modulation. Due to its activity, it has been extensively used as a research tool in biochemical and pharmacological studies to investigate the mechanisms of vitamin D action, its receptor signaling pathways, and its role in various physiological and pathological processes, such as bone metabolism, cancer, and autoimmune diseases. As a research-grade biochemical, it is not used as a therapeutic API in clinical practice but serves as a critical reference standard and probe in life science research. Its synthesis and availability support ongoing investigations into vitamin D endocrinology and the development of novel vitamin D analogs with potential therapeutic applications.
